Our Take on Each
Cursor
Best for: AI-native, whole-codebase editing
Cursor is what you get when the entire editor is designed around AI, and for agentic, multi-file changes it's ahead of the plugins. It understands your codebase in a way bolt-on tools can't. Heavy use burns through limits fast, and it can get a little too eager with edits.
Tabnine
Best for: Privacy-focused and enterprise teams
Tabnine's whole pitch is privacy — it can run locally or on-prem and learn from your own code, which matters when security rules are strict. Its raw suggestions aren't as sharp as Copilot's, but for regulated teams that trade-off is usually worth making.
